Job Title: Quality Manager Division 40

Job Location: MNP, Madison Heights, Michigan

Job Schedule: Dayshift Monday - Friday; some weekends and evenings may be required

About us: MNP is an award-winning fastener manufacturer specializing in diameters from M3 to M24. Established in 1970, it is a family-owned business with core values of Humility, Integrity, Trust, Compassion and Dedication. MNP controls the complete manufacturing process from the annealing of the raw coiled steel through heading, rolling, heat treating, plating, coating, packaging, and distributing. Employees at MNP work together in teams yet work without constant supervision. MNP seeks to promote from within and offers training and development at all levels of the organization; 75% of all leadership positions are held by employees who were promoted from within.

About the role of Quality Manager: The Quality Manager oversees the quality of our company's manufacturing output. The quality manager will ensure our manufacturing processes are consistent to meet government industry standards and customer expectations.

Responsibilities of Quality Manager: Customer Concern Management; responsible for receiving, tracking,

assessing, and responding to customer issues.

Responding in 24 hours and closing on-time with a competent response,

including customer / supplier visits to identify root cause and actions.

Internal Quality Concern/ DMR Candice process management for timely and

appropriate containment, disposition, corrective action, and analysis.

Audit System Compliance: IATF 16949, ISO 14001, ISO 17025, & Customer

Specific; this includes Root Cause, Corrective, and Preventative Action.

Implementation; and Preventive Action responses to all quality concerns and

audit non conformances. (5Y/8D/DDW, etc.)

Develop/ Maintain SOP's/Operator Work Instructions; conduct training as

appropriate.

Manage/ Maintain Process Control Plans, PFMEA's and RPN Reduction Plans.

Conduct/ Manage Layered Audit program to assure control plan

adherence/ applicability.

Manage Continuous Improvement process/QOS; utilizing customer feedback,

internal isolations, and sort fall out details. Including Cost of Poor Quality and

other key quality metrics.

Support Shop Floor Operations; including daily management of process

compliance, supporting operators with troubleshooting issues that may arise.

Conduct / Support Management Review Process; Continuous Improvement and

ISO/TS 16949 Compliance.

Support New Business APQP/PPAP process; Gage MSA; SPC/ Cpk/Ppk

process/ New Part Set up in SRP (shop floor database)

Quality Leadership/ Foster culture of TEAMWORK; Lead and support the

cultural change in the quality function, from detecting and responding to quality

issues, to one that prevents issues from occurring in the first place.
